diff --git a/sgzb-modules/sgzb-base/src/main/java/com/bonus/sgzb/app/service/impl/BackApplyServiceImpl.java b/sgzb-modules/sgzb-base/src/main/java/com/bonus/sgzb/app/service/impl/BackApplyServiceImpl.java index 796c78fe..80a1d8fc 100644 --- a/sgzb-modules/sgzb-base/src/main/java/com/bonus/sgzb/app/service/impl/BackApplyServiceImpl.java +++ b/sgzb-modules/sgzb-base/src/main/java/com/bonus/sgzb/app/service/impl/BackApplyServiceImpl.java @@ -141,14 +141,18 @@ public class BackApplyServiceImpl implements BackApplyService { public int audit(BackApplyInfo record) { int num = 0; Set roles = SecurityUtils.getLoginUser().getRoles(); - String username = SecurityUtils.getLoginUser().getUsername(); + Long companyId = SecurityUtils.getLoginUser().getSysUser().getCompanyId(); String userId = String.valueOf(SecurityUtils.getLoginUser().getUserid()); record.setCreateBy(userId); - if (roles.contains("jjfgs") || roles.contains("admin")) { + if (roles.contains("admin")) { record.setStatus("1"); backApplyMapper.audit(record); } - if (roles.contains("tsfgs") || roles.contains("admin")) { + if (companyId != null && companyId.equals(101)) { + record.setStatus("1"); + backApplyMapper.audit(record); + } + if (companyId != null && companyId.equals(102)) { record.setStatus("3"); backApplyMapper.audit(record); } @@ -172,12 +176,17 @@ public class BackApplyServiceImpl implements BackApplyService { int num = 0; Set roles = SecurityUtils.getLoginUser().getRoles(); Long userid = SecurityUtils.getLoginUser().getUserid(); + Long companyId = SecurityUtils.getLoginUser().getSysUser().getCompanyId(); record.setCreateBy(userid.toString()); - if (roles.contains("jjfgs") || roles.contains("admin")) { + if (roles.contains("admin")) { record.setStatus("2"); return backApplyMapper.refuse(record); } - if (roles.contains("tsfgs") || roles.contains("admin")) { + if (companyId != null && companyId.equals(101)) { + record.setStatus("2"); + return backApplyMapper.refuse(record); + } + if (companyId != null && companyId.equals(101)) { record.setStatus("4"); return backApplyMapper.refuse(record); }